Transaction 1f343c21cecc2c86d50b99cfef84f6065dd9c0a62d8fb28950eb2e3dfa10e4de
1 Input
1 Output
-
1f343c21cecc2c86d50b99cfef84f6065dd9c0a62d8fb28950eb2e3dfa10e4de:0
- value
- 1078637
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8722ba6c87f902a1f99ee7a960d7215f4dbfdef
- address
- bc1qepezhfkg07gz58ueaeafvrtjzh6dhl005gjeys